University of Dallas - Haggerty Gallery


The Haggerty Gallery is an integral component of the University of Dallas Art Department, and its exhibitions are designed to encourage a dialogue between the University of Dallas and the broader artistic community by inviting an array of contemporary artists, both national and international, to the university's campus.

Directions & Parking
The Haggerty Gallery, located in the Haggerty Arts Village, is the copper-clad building at the corner of Gorman Drive and Haggar Circle. Parking is available throughout campus.
